你查询的IP:[60.224.77.127]  地理位置:澳大利亚Telstra网络

最新查询218.105.204.83 120.47.170.76 120.156.144.134 60.189.253.164 221.61.144.156 202.90.0.49 119.91.47.189 120.89.70.141 119.182.222.56 60.224.77.127 202.8.128.207 58.30.61.51 118.242.54.32 119.40.64.32 220.231.128.196 58.144.12.39 210.185.192.215 123.243.128.238 124.242.65.221 202.127.160.183 119.28.29.201 124.128.57.127 121.224.31.221 221.199.93.37 58.100.70.50 202.130.190.102 211.96.228.28 117.122.128.142 203.99.16.23 119.32.161.6 202.158.160.28